Non-recommended Paper The following types of paper are not recommended for this machine: • Roughly cut paper • Paper of different thickness in the same stack • Envelopes heavier than 85 g/m2, 22 lb. • Folded, curled, creased, or damaged paper • Damp paper • Torn paper • Slippery paper • Rough paper • Paper with any kind of coating (such as carbon) • Short grain paper • Thin paper that has low stiffness • Paper that is prone to generate a lot of paper dust • Grained paper loaded with the direction of the grain perpendicular to the feed direction • Certain types of long thin envelopes. E.g. international mail envelopes ZFXX040E 29
